Is it rude to contact several professors? by Sea_Raccoon_9673 in stanford

[–]equilateral_pupper 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Doesn't seem rude to me, i would contact them individually and then tailor your message re why you are interested in working with them. If you show genuine interest and turn down others gracefully if you get multiple positions then you'll be fine.
